Add condition to detect PE installations and provide different parameters
This commit is contained in:
parent
7dde8c3e36
commit
63f1c52d8b
1 changed files with 16 additions and 7 deletions
|
@ -46,12 +46,21 @@ class puppetdb::params {
|
||||||
}
|
}
|
||||||
}
|
}
|
||||||
|
|
||||||
# TODO: need to condition this for PE
|
if $::puppetversion =~ /Puppet Enterprise/ {
|
||||||
|
$puppetdb_package = 'pe-puppetdb'
|
||||||
|
$puppetdb_service = 'pe-puppetdb'
|
||||||
|
$confdir = '/etc/puppetlabs/puppetdb/conf.d'
|
||||||
|
$puppet_service_name = 'pe-httpd'
|
||||||
|
$puppet_confdir = '/etc/puppetlabs/puppet'
|
||||||
|
$terminus_package = 'pe-puppetdb-terminus'
|
||||||
|
} else {
|
||||||
$puppetdb_package = 'puppetdb'
|
$puppetdb_package = 'puppetdb'
|
||||||
$puppetdb_service = 'puppetdb'
|
$puppetdb_service = 'puppetdb'
|
||||||
$confdir = '/etc/puppetdb/conf.d'
|
$confdir = '/etc/puppetdb/conf.d'
|
||||||
$puppet_service_name = 'puppetmaster'
|
$puppet_service_name = 'puppetmaster'
|
||||||
$puppet_confdir = '/etc/puppet'
|
$puppet_confdir = '/etc/puppet'
|
||||||
$puppet_conf = "${puppet_confdir}/puppet.conf"
|
|
||||||
$terminus_package = 'puppetdb-terminus'
|
$terminus_package = 'puppetdb-terminus'
|
||||||
|
}
|
||||||
|
|
||||||
|
$puppet_conf = "${puppet_confdir}/puppet.conf"
|
||||||
}
|
}
|
||||||
|
|
Loading…
Reference in a new issue